Black Sand Basin is a place located in Yellowstone National Park (Wyoming state) and belongs to the category of bridge.

It is situated at an altitude of 7280 feet, and its geographical coordinates are 44°27'42"N latitude and 110°51'14"W longitude.

Among other places and attractions worth visiting in the area are: Emerald Pool (park, 2 min walk), Black Sand Basin Hot Springs (hot springs, 2 min walk), Daisy Geyser (natural attraction, 19 min walk).
